The 100 mile diet is interesting. You only eat food that is produced within 100 miles of where you live. The diet ties most environmental concerns together in a nice little package. Like global warming, transporation of food, concern for the local farmer, organic farming, and knowing what you're eating. On the website, you can look up your 100 mile radius. Living in Seattle, you can eat almost any local fish, most things at local farmers markets and Yakima hops.
